 Rebecca Enonchong born 1967 is a Cameeoonian born technology entrepreneur and also the founder and CEO of AppsTech. She is best known for her work promoting technology in Africa.

Enonchong has been a recipient of various awards from organizations such as the World Economic Forum.

Cameroon’s Tech Queen Rebecca Enonchong Makes Cover Of Forbes Africa March Issue Featuring 50 Most Powerful Women!

The Tech queen has made it to the cover of the Forbes Africa Magazine March Issue that features Africa’s 50 most powerful women.

The cover of the magazine features Cameroon’s techprenuer Rebecca Enonchong,

South African businesswoman Irene Charnley, South African media personality Bonang Matheba and Uganda’s Winnie Byanyima.

Forbes Africa labeled those listed as ”Africa most influential and impactful ceiling cashers, movers and shakers”.

This list outlines those who have been leading ideas and industries while purposefully contributing to nation-building and positively impacting the lives around them.
